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69034 41736549 14 629739
18965 030281 30
18965 030281 30
853973506 98 1447890781 571423458 88
All about undefined
Interested in learning more?
18965 030281 30
853973506 98 1447890781 571423458 88
See more
0391266181 6194
433 7025333 75314
See more
59259268 90718 9575164
9520 26 35 01 105874664
See more